Free Worldwide DeliveryA charming take on a snake ring Art Deco style! This ring was made circa 1930-1940 in America. It is platinum and iridium, a sturdy mix of metals that the American jewellers often used in jewellery. The head of the snake is a claw set pear shaped diamond and the body has been set with graduated baguette cut diamonds.
Snake rings were very popular in the Georgian, Victorian and Edwardian and Art Deco periods as they represented “Eternal love and wisdom”. This example is beautifully made and is top quality of its type.
